The plug fouling on these might be caused by old fuel, but it can also happen if the "choke" is used too liberally. It basically dumps fuel into the float bowls and causes carbon foulding FAST. Really the only drawback of the VTX1300.
And who uses the choke for anything other than warming the bike up? Why would anyone want to use it for anything else?
@@scottg429 yes, that's literally what it's used for. Believe it or not, some people live in places where the "choke" (in quotes because it's actually an enrichment circuit here, not a true choke) is a thing they need to use regularly. You answered your own question, but thanks.

You might want to put engine guards on this because if you ever go down you are not going to lift it off your leg to get out from underneath to get free. Trust me, I have been there. And, rejet the carb a little bigger as these come lean from the factory to meet federal emission standards.
I'll take this 1300 over the 1800 any day. This bike sounds so much better than the 1800 engine in my opinion. Those 1800 VTX's have those dual crankpin crankshafts, the 1300 has a single crankpin crankshaft. Single crankpin engines just sound more pleasing to the ear to me.
I agree, the 1800 might be a beast for power, but the 1300 has that classic single pin sound, which we all like..
The VTX 1300 is curbureted and consumes roughly the same fuel as the much larger VTX 1800. I enjoy my Shadow Sabre 1100.
Well, if sound is all you care about, then sure, the 1300 may be the better option for you. Its not like the 1800 sounds awful though....just doesn't have that classic single pin "potato, potato, potato" sound most V-twins are famous for. Of course, what it does have is a boat load more power and torque, a smooth, trouble free EFI system and tremendously better brakes by comparison. Personally, I wouldn't let a little thing like an exhaust note make my decision for me....which is probably why I bought the 1800 instead. To each their own, of course.
